What affects the price

Building an ADU involves variables that shift your total investment. The footprint size and complexity of the architectural design are primary factors. Are you planning a detached unit that requires new utility trenching, or is this a garage conversion that uses existing plumbing? Site accessibility, soil conditions, and your choice of finishes—like luxury flooring versus standard options—also play significant roles. What are the disadvantages of ADUs?

Potential disadvantages can include increased utility costs, the initial construction expense, and potential impacts on yard space. However, these are often offset by the benefits of added living space and potential rental income. Careful planning can mitigate these concerns.

What are the rules for ADUs in Minneapolis?

Minneapolis has specific zoning ordinances and building codes that govern ADU construction. These typically address lot size, setbacks, height limits, and parking. Professionals familiar with these local regulations will ensure your project is compliant.
